Combine cream cheese, 1 cup of cheese and seasoning. Spread into bottom of a 1-quart baking dish. Top cream cheese mixture with salsa. Sprinkle remaining 3/4 cup cheese on top of salsa.
Bake for 15-20 minutes.
Notes:
Feel free to add some veggies or meat to the dip. Onions, bell peppers, olives, ground beef, or chicken would all be delicious.
The flavor and heat will all depend on what salsa you choose.

Can Hot Salsa Dip be made in advance? Yes! You can assemble the dip ahead of time and refrigerate until ready to bake and serve.
Can Hot Salsa Dip be made in the slow cooker? Yes! Assemble the dip and spread into the crockpot. Cover and cook until warm.
